Kenneth J. Bagstad is affiliated with the United States Geological Survey in the United States. Their research primarily spans the field of Environmental Science with a strong focus on subfields such as Global and Planetary Change, Economics and Econometrics, Environmental Engineering, Management, Monitoring, Policy and Law, and Ocean Engineering.

The main topics in Kenneth J. Bagstad's work include Land Use and Ecosystem Services, Economic and Environmental Valuation, Conservation, Biodiversity, and Resource Management, Urban Heat Island Mitigation, Water Resources Management and Optimization, Urban Green Space and Health, and Sustainable Development and Environmental Policy.

Recent papers authored or coauthored by Kenneth J. Bagstad encompass:

  • Progress in natural capital accounting for ecosystems (2020), published in Science
  • Quantifying interregional flows of multiple ecosystem services - A case study for Germany (2020), published in Global Environmental Change
  • A rasterized building footprint dataset for the United States (2020), published in Scientific Data
  • Lessons learned from development of natural capital accounts in the United States and European Union (2021), published in Ecosystem Services
  • Accounting for land in the United States: Integrating physical land cover, land use, and monetary valuation (2020), published in Ecosystem Services
